Output 6517748ac89300c89af33941481207d18dfb019241bb486f98d0826fd6091cf3:1

value
35290440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b026a1d60a95ca2e42f9453f526d0a8eb3db7c5b OP_EQUALVERIFY OP_CHECKSIG
address
1H4QCyQdDio56VaWvXGUFdmUNFQDcMXyvo
transaction
6517748ac89300c89af33941481207d18dfb019241bb486f98d0826fd6091cf3
confirmations
377495
spent
true